While the car was fine and customer service appeared to be adequate, about a month after the rental, I received a bill from Thriftyrentalfine.com. We had gone through several tolls in Colorado during our time there (6 to be exact), all under $5 each, totaling just over $20. The bill was for $100.65 as Thrifty assessed "Admin Fees" of $15 per toll charge for $90 in fees. You can't pay tolls live in Colorado as there are no booths. So, they take a picture of your license and send it to the registration address (Thrifty) who pays the tolls and then charges you a ridiculous amount.

    When I called customer service, and explained that there was no way for me to have avoided these fees (as you can't pay tolls live), then I could have signed up for their "Platepass" all-inclusive toll program. This would be to pay a flat daily fee to cover all tolls (I think it was $15/day; for us that would have been $105 for a week). So, there was NO POSSIBLE WAY to just pay the tolls...unless you knew to contact the Colorado toll authority and open an account with them and call them to give them the license plate number of the car and your address so they can bill you directly.

    Of course, NONE OF THIS INFORMATION was given to me when I picked up the car (some of it was buried deep in the rental agreement). But, this seems to me to be information you would tell customers so they can avoid unnecessary charges...unless you don't want them to know so that the company makes more with their two possible solutions.     Secondly, we were never offered Plate Pass or even told how it works only to find out three states later that because of Covid all tolls are cashless. We didn't have the Plate Pass so there was a $15.00 fee from Thrifty every time you used a toll road on top of the toll. I read up on the tolls. If you drove through a toll and didn't have that particular's state Toll Pass they would mail you the toll and you would simply pay it. No fees tagged on. BUT since the vehicle is registered to Thrifty the toll charge goes directly to Thrifty and they tag an administrative fee of $15.00 per toll right to your credit card. Knowing that we were traveling a great distance this should have been mentioned.
